The performance report of new energy vehicle companies in June is out! LI AUTO-W regains the top spot in new forces sales

According to the Financial Intelligence APP, on July 1st, several car companies released their June sales data for new energy vehicles. Many car companies performed well, with LI AUTO-W (02015) delivering over 40,000 units in a single month, reclaiming the top spot among new energy vehicle manufacturers. NIO-SW (09866) and ZEEKR (ZK.US) both delivered over 20,000 units in a single month, reaching a new historical high.

Specifically, in terms of new energy vehicle manufacturers, LI AUTO continued to top the list of new car deliveries for the month. In June 2024, LI AUTO delivered 47,774 new cars, a year-on-year increase of 46.7%. In the second quarter of 2024, deliveries reached 108,581 units, a year-on-year increase of 25.5%. As of June 30, 2024, LI AUTO's cumulative delivery volume reached 822,345 units, ranking first among Chinese new energy vehicle brands in total deliveries.

LI AUTO's Chairman and CEO, Li Xiang, stated that the sales momentum of the LI series continued to rise in June, with LI 6 delivering over 20,000 units and the total monthly delivery volume of all series exceeding 40,000 units. Since the second quarter, with the dual effect of the new LI 6 model launch and improved store efficiency, LI AUTO has returned to the top of the sales list for Chinese new energy vehicle brands and won the title of the best-selling Chinese automotive brand in the new energy vehicle market above 200,000 RMB.

Official data shows that as of June 30, 2024, LI AUTO has 497 retail centers nationwide, covering 148 cities; 421 after-sales service and authorized body repair centers, covering 220 cities. LI AUTO has put into operation 614 LI Supercharging stations nationwide, with 2,726 charging piles.

Geely Auto (00175) sold a total of 166,085 vehicles in June 2024, a year-on-year increase of 24%, and the group's management team decided to raise the full-year sales target by about 5%, from 1.9 million units to 2 million units.

In June 2024, XPeng Motors-W (09868) delivered a total of 10,668 new cars, a year-on-year increase of 24% and a month-on-month increase of 5%. Among them, the XPeng X9 "Nine Crown King" delivered 1,687 units, with a total of 13,143 units delivered in the first half year since its launch, leading the pure electric MPV and pure electric three-row seat vehicle market. From January to June 2024, XPeng Motors delivered a total of 52,028 new cars, a year-on-year increase of 26%.

In June 2024, NIO delivered a total of 21,209 new cars, a year-on-year increase of 98%, reaching a historical high. In the second quarter of 2024, NIO delivered 57,373 new cars, exceeding the delivery guidance, with a year-on-year increase of 143.9%. In the first half of 2024, NIO delivered a total of 87,426 new cars, a year-on-year increase of 60.2%. As of now, NIO has delivered a total of 537,020 new cars.

ZEEKR delivered 20,106 units in June 2024, a significant year-on-year increase of 89% and a month-on-month increase of 8%, breaking the 20,000 mark for the first time and reaching a historical high. In the first half of this year, ZEEKR delivered a total of 87,870 vehicles, a year-on-year increase of 106%, aiming to become the best-selling pure electric brand in China with over 200,000 units in 2024. Among them, ZEEKR 001 has delivered over 10,000 units for three consecutive months and has firmly held the top spot in the category of pure electric vehicles with over 250,000 units sold. By the end of June, ZEEKR has delivered over 280,000 vehicles.

In addition, Voyah saw an 83% year-on-year increase in deliveries in June, with a total of 30,376 units delivered in the first half of the year, a 102% increase year-on-year. IM Motors sold 6,015 vehicles in June, a 200% increase year-on-year, a 41% increase month-on-month, and a significant 200% increase year-on-year, entering the top ten in sales among "new forces in the Chinese market." SAIC-GM-Wuling's new energy vehicle sales reached 44,126 units, a 372.04% increase year-on-year, with SAIC-GM-Wuling vehicles accounting for 41,457 units, a 631.42% increase year-on-year. SAIC Group sold over 93,000 new energy vehicles in June, with cumulative sales exceeding 460,000 units in the first half of the year, a 24% year-on-year increase.

Previously, data released by the China Passenger Car Association showed that in June, the retail sales of new energy passenger vehicles in China are expected to reach 860,000 units, a 6.9% increase month-on-month and a 32.7% increase year-on-year, with a penetration rate expected to rise to 49.1%. The association stated, "Driven by the dual factors of new product launches and price reductions, the new energy market size will continue to grow steadily, with the penetration rate expected to reach a historical high."

The China Automobile Dealers Association stated that in June, the passenger car market entered the final period of the first half of the year, with strong willingness from car manufacturers and dealers to boost sales performance. In addition, incentives such as the "scrappage for new" policy and large-scale promotional activities like "618" have also contributed to the continued high demand for car purchases in June.

Looking ahead to the market performance, a research report from CITIC Securities is optimistic about the full-year sales volume and overseas prospects of the new energy vehicle market this year, especially with the "scrappage for new" policy introduced at the end of April expected to significantly boost annual sales. The sector's beta coefficient is expected to perform better in the second half of the year compared to the first half.
